Ethical Implications of Birth Control Access
Access to and use of birth control are deeply intertwined with religious, cultural, and personal beliefs. Some religious groups hold strong views against contraception, viewing it as morally objectionable. Conversely, many other faiths support family planning and access to reproductive healthcare. Cultural norms also significantly influence attitudes towards birth control, with some cultures emphasizing large families while others prioritize smaller family sizes. Personal beliefs regarding reproductive rights and bodily autonomy further shape individual choices and perspectives on the ethics of birth control. These diverse perspectives highlight the complexity of ethical considerations surrounding birth control access.
Societal Impact of Widespread Birth Control Access
Widespread access to birth control has demonstrable societal impacts. Reduced fertility rates can lead to slower population growth, potentially easing pressure on resources and infrastructure in densely populated areas, as seen in many European countries over the past few decades. Furthermore, increased access to birth control is strongly correlated with improved women’s empowerment, enabling them to pursue education and careers without the constraints of unplanned pregnancies. This empowerment can positively contribute to economic development through increased female participation in the workforce and enhanced family well-being. Conversely, rapid declines in fertility rates can also present challenges, such as an aging population and potential labor shortages, as is currently being observed in Japan.
Unintended Consequences of Increased Birth Control Use
While increased birth control use offers numerous benefits, potential unintended consequences warrant attention. Changes in family structures, such as smaller family sizes or delayed childbearing, may impact social support systems and intergenerational relationships. Significant shifts in fertility rates can also have long-term demographic effects, potentially affecting the age structure of a population and straining social security systems. For example, the one-child policy in China, while initially successful in curbing population growth, led to a skewed sex ratio at birth and an aging population, presenting challenges for future economic growth and social welfare.
Examples of Birth Control Initiatives
The success of birth control initiatives varies significantly across regions. Programs that prioritize education, readily available services, and community engagement often demonstrate greater effectiveness. For instance, the family planning programs implemented in Bangladesh have significantly reduced fertility rates and improved maternal health outcomes through community-based outreach and accessible healthcare services. Conversely, initiatives that lack adequate resources, fail to address cultural sensitivities, or face strong opposition from religious or political groups have often been less successful. The failure of some programs in sub-Saharan Africa to effectively reach marginalized communities highlights the importance of culturally appropriate strategies and community participation.
The Role of Education and Open Communication
Education and open communication are paramount in promoting responsible birth control choices. Comprehensive sex education programs that address reproductive health, contraception, and sexually transmitted infections are crucial in empowering individuals to make informed decisions. Open and honest communication within families and communities can help to reduce stigma and encourage responsible sexual behavior. This approach fosters a supportive environment where individuals feel comfortable seeking information and accessing services, ultimately contributing to positive reproductive health outcomes. Countries with robust sex education programs and accessible healthcare often show higher rates of contraceptive use and lower rates of unintended pregnancies.

Future of Birth Control Technology
Advancements in birth control are poised to offer more personalized, effective, and accessible options. Hormonal implants are likely to become even more sophisticated, potentially incorporating features like on-demand control or adjustable hormone release. Non-hormonal options, such as improved barrier methods and advancements in fertility awareness apps incorporating sophisticated algorithms, will also see significant development. The quest for effective male contraception remains a priority, with ongoing research into hormonal and non-hormonal methods, including potential advancements in vasalgel-like technologies showing promise. The development of reversible methods, with minimal side effects, will be crucial. For example, research into new hormonal implants that minimize side effects like weight gain or mood swings is a significant area of focus. Similarly, non-hormonal options like improved intrauterine devices (IUDs) with longer lifespans are constantly being developed.
Artificial Intelligence and Machine Learning in Birth Control
AI and machine learning are poised to revolutionize access and usage of birth control. AI-powered apps can provide personalized recommendations based on individual health data, lifestyle factors, and preferences, improving adherence and efficacy. Machine learning algorithms can analyze vast datasets to identify patterns and predict potential complications, enabling proactive interventions and personalized care. For instance, an AI-powered app could track a woman’s cycle and predict ovulation, improving the effectiveness of natural family planning methods. Furthermore, AI could assist in the development of new contraceptives by analyzing large datasets of biological information to identify potential drug targets.
